What is U about?

Status: Finished

Yuu has spent her entire life with a “copy” of herself, her twin sister. Now science has created a copy more perfect than nature ever could, and Yuu seems like the perfect test subject. But as her copy becomes more intelligent day by day and begins questioning its own existence, the experiment threatens to spiral out of control. Who is real and who is a copy? And what is a “copy” that has surpassed its original? Just a copy, the original, or something else entirely?

Hanshin: Half-God

Hanshin

Also known as Hanshin: Half-God.

Status: Finished
Genres: Drama , Psychological

Conjoined twins Yudy and Yucy are as different as possible. Older Yudy is intelligent but ugly, as her nutrients are used up by her beautiful but simpleminded sister Yucy. Loving and hating so deeply, where does one girl begin and the other end?

Note: Published in English as a part of the "A Drunken Dream and Other Stories" manga anthology by Fantagraphics.

A, A'

A: A'

Also known as A, A'.

Status: Finished
Genres: Drama , Psychological , Romance , Sci-Fi

A volume of short sci-fi shoujo stories all featuring a new race of humans called Unicorns. The major theme in all of the stories are about human emotions. As the characters in the story try to interact and relate to these Unicorns who lack a lot of the natural emotions humans normally feel.

The story A, A' raises a troubling question: how would you feel if your lover died—and was replaced by a clone? Could you recreate your relationship with someone who was physically exactly the same but didn't share any memories of your life together?

In 4/4, teenaged Mori flunks out of an ESP training program. But when he meets Trill, a beautiful Unicorn, his latent abilities begin to blossom...

In X+Y, Hagio uses science fiction to explore questions of gender and sexual identity. Time has passed, and once again, Mori finds himself inexorably attracted to a member of the unicorn race - but this unicorn is male... and so is Mori.

Tomie

Tomie

Status: Finished
Genres: Drama , Fantasy , Horror , Supernatural , Thriller

Tomie Kawakami is a femme fatale with long black hair and a beauty mark just under her left eye. She can seduce nearly any man, and drive them to murder as well, even though the victim is often Tomie herself. While one lover seeks to keep her for himself, another grows terrified of the immortal succubus. But soon they realize that no matter how many times they kill her, the world will never be free of Tomie.



Notes:
While a collection of mainly independent short stories, Tomie was originally published as Volumes 1 and 2 of the Ito Junji Kyofu Manga Collection. This entry is for the standalone release of Tomie first published in February 2000 with previously unreleased chapter "小指/Little Finger".
Later collections such as the 'Complete Deluxe edition' by Viz combines this and the sequel entry Tomie: Again for a total of 20 chapters.
The short story “Painter” has been adapted in the first part of episode 9 of Ito Junji: Collection.
